First, this isn't in your head

Before the "why," I wanted the "how much," because I didn't trust my own memory. Turns out the government tracks this. The Bureau of Labor Statistics keeps a price index for televisions, and it's the honest kind of number: it holds quality steady, so it measures the price of the same TV over time, not just "TVs got bigger."

By that measure, an equivalent television got roughly 30% cheaper in five years. And the year-by-year story is even better than the headline, because prices dropped every single year, except one.

Blog image

That one exception, 2021, is my favorite part. For a single year, TVs got more expensive, about 6% up, because a pandemic snarled the supply of panels and shipping. And I love that, because it quietly proves the whole point: this isn't gravity. Prices don't fall because of some law of nature. They fall because someone, somewhere, decided to make them fall, and the one time the machine jammed, the price went the other way. When it un-jammed, prices didn't just resume falling. They fell harder.

So something is pushing. I wanted to know what.

Why the box got so cheap

Most of a television's cost was never the brand or the software. It was the panel, the sheet of glass itself. And over the last decade, that panel has turned into a commodity, much like flour or plywood. A handful of enormous, heavily state-subsidized manufacturers in China now make around 60% of the world's display capacity, and they'll sell panels at prices their competitors literally can't survive. Last year, LG sold off its final big LCD TV factory. The race to the bottom was over, and China won it.

Once the expensive part is a commodity, nobody can make money selling the box anymore. And they're not even trying. Roku, over a recent stretch, sold its hardware at a negative 7.6% margin, meaning it lost money on every device, on purpose. A former CTO at Vizio said the quiet part into a microphone at a tech conference: "I really don't need to make money off of the TV. I need to cover my cost… you sell some movies, you sell some TV shows, you sell some ads."

The TV isn't the product they're selling you. The TV is the bait they use to get the real product into your living room.

So what's the real product?

You. Or more precisely, everything your television can learn about what you watch.

Most modern smart TVs run something called ACR, automatic content recognition. Here's what it actually does, and this is the part that made me put my ZOA down: the TV takes tiny screenshots of whatever is on the screen, over and over, and matches them against a giant reference library to identify exactly what you're watching. Samsung's own advertising materials describe grabbing a snapshot of the screen every 500 milliseconds. Twice a second. All day.

And it doesn't care where the picture comes from. Cable, streaming, a DVD, and the news. Even when you're using the TV as a plain monitor for a game console or a laptop, the screen-watching keeps going. It only stops if you dig into the settings and turn it off, which almost nobody does, because almost nobody knows it's there.

I kept waiting for the part where this turns out to be a paranoid exaggeration. It doesn't. Back in 2017, the Federal Trade Commission caught Vizio doing exactly this on 11 million televisions, collecting second-by-second viewing, as many as 100 billion data points a day, then attaching it to household details like age, income, and marital status and selling it on. Not a rumor. A federal settlement. And this spring, it got current again: Texas sued Samsung, LG, Sony, Hisense, and TCL over the same kind of tracking, and Samsung actually switched ACR off, for Texas viewers only.

Where AI comes in, and where it lied to me

Here's the connection I was actually chasing. If the data is the product, then the business only works if the TVs are everywhere. Not in wealthy homes. Everywhere. Every income level, every spare bedroom, every kid's room. A loss-leader only pays off at saturation, which means the whole model quietly depends on the hardware being cheap enough that literally anyone can afford it. The low price isn't generosity. It's customer acquisition for a data business.

And AI is what turns that raw viewing data into money at a scale that wasn't possible before, by stitching viewers into detailed profiles and generating swarms of individually targeted ads, tuned to the person on the couch. The cheap TV feeds the data. The data feeds the AI. The AI makes the data worth more, which justifies making the TV even cheaper. Round and round.

Now, the part I promised. When I first pointed AI at this whole question, it handed me a clean, confident summary that said, in effect, AI made TVs cheap. And that's wrong. Backwards, even. Subsidized factories made TVs cheap. AI just showed up to feast on what the cheapness made possible. The AI's most confident sentence was its least correct one, and if I'd just published it, I'd have taught all of you something false with total conviction.

What I actually want you to do with this

Don't throw out your TV. I'm not going to throw out mine. The thing is genuinely great, and the free ad-supported channels it unlocked are a real gift for a big family on one screen budget. Here's the honest version: for plenty of households, this might be a fair trade. Cheap hardware, free shows, in exchange for data you don't particularly care about. That can be a perfectly good deal.

The problem was never that a trade exists. The problem is that the trade is hidden: defaulted on, buried three menus deep, and made on your behalf before you knew there was anything to decide. With nine kids growing up with screens in this house, what bothers me isn't the ads. It's the quiet lesson that being watched is just the normal background hum of owning things. I'd rather they learn to notice the trade and choose it on purpose.

So that's the whole ask. Go into your TV's settings tonight and find the ACR option. It'll be called something friendly like "viewing information" or "smart interactivity." Look at it. Then decide, on purpose, whether you want it on or off. Somebody reading this needed to know that the switch existed. If that's you, that's the whole reason I wrote this down.
